"Israeli PR efforts in Britain have kicked up a notch since Prosor became ambassador two months ago." [1]

Israeli ambassador Ron Prosor is reported to be the 'brainchild' of an 'aggressive new strategy' in Britain with the aim of 'making Israel’s case more actively in the media and taking their message out of London'. Prosor was formerly director-general of Israel’s Foreign Ministry[2]
